Structure Reclaimed in the Asia-London Crossover
$SOL cleared its nearest resistance at $75.95 during the Asia-London session, stabilizing near $76.03 with $958M in 24h volume. This level had acted as a pivot in recent sessions, and the break represents a shift in short-term momentum. Price is now operating above what had been a congestion zone, signaling buyers are willing to defend this ground.
The Path to $78.93
The next structural resistance target sits at $78.93 - a 3.8% move from current levels. This level carries weight on the 4H timeframe as a swing high and confluence zone where prior volatility compressed. Reaching it would require sustained buying pressure and volume confirmation above $76.50. Watch for rejection or acceptance at intermediate levels like $77.20 and $77.65 - these micro-resistances often reveal whether momentum is genuine or exhausted.
Support Anchors and Pattern Development
On the downside, $75.95 now functions as a freshly-broken resistance turned support. A close below this level would invalidate the breakout and retest the prior congestion zone around $74.80. The 24h range of just 0.98% suggests consolidation energy - price hasn't extended decisively, indicating traders are positioning rather than chasing. RSI and MACD signals on the 4H should be monitored for divergence; rising price with flattening momentum often precedes a pullback or reversal.
Session Context and Volume
The $958M daily volume is moderate for $SOL and typical of range-bound structure. Breakouts of similar magnitude historically require volume above $1.2B to sustain moves beyond the first resistance. The current session's ability to hold above $76 while staying beneath $77 suggests price is testing buyer conviction without committing to a trend extension. Watch for the New York session open to bring fresh liquidity and volatility - this is when larger institution traders often set directional bias.
Social metrics from LunarCrush show 86% positive sentiment and a Galaxy Score of 65/100, indicating moderate social health aligned with technical positioning. However, social strength does not predict price - it reflects existing trader optimism and should be weighted against on-chain flows and derivatives data.
